In the enchanting city of Paris, where the aroma of freshly baked croissants mingles with the sweet sounds of accordion music, an extraordinary tale of love, redemption, and self-discovery begins. Meet Eddie, the smooth-talking maestro from the heart of New Orleans. With a swagger as impressive as the Mississippi River itself, Eddie decides to leave behind the familiar jazz-filled streets of the Big Easy to explore the world. Paris beckons, not just for its musical education, but to see a world beyond the confines of his hometown. And then there's Aurora, a radiant and compassionate soul hailing from the sun-soaked landscapes of Italy. She carries a heavy burden from her past, escaping the clutches of an abusive father with her younger sister, yet unable to rescue all of her family. Their destinies collide on a picturesque Parisian street, amidst a sea of vibrant flowers. Eddie, concealing his own secrets, and Aurora, guarding her heart, find themselves drawn to each other. In the midst of the City of Light's timeless beauty, they embark on a quest for the elusive spark known as love. But can they truly overcome the shadows of their pasts that threaten to engulf them? Will Eddie, the eternal wanderer, finally learn to commit and discover his true self? Can Aurora, the resilient protector, learn to let go and save her remaining family members? Or will the complexities of life, love, and their own inner battles prove too formidable to conquer? As they navigate the cobblestone streets and hidden alleys of Paris, their entwined fates hang in the balance, and the world watches to see if they can triumph in the ultimate game called life. Paris becomes not just the backdrop but a character itself in this gripping saga of love and redemption, a place where two souls dare to rewrite their destinies and create a melody of hope in the symphony of life.
